Handover — Vexler partner SFTP drop

Ownership moves to you today. Drop runs hourly from Vexler's end into the intake bucket via the relay host. Watch for zero-byte files; their exporter flakes on Mondays. Creds live in the ops vault, path noted in the runbook. Vault auto-seals after 48h idle. Support escalations go to the on-call rotation, not me. If the vault is sealed when you need it, unseal with the recovery passphrase below.

recovery phrase for tadug-fafof: zorwyn-kasion

## Deploying the Gatewick Proctor Queue

Deploys are pretty painless: push to main, wait for the pipeline, then watch the queue drain dashboard for five minutes. If candidates pile up mid-exam, roll back first and ask questions later — the queue replays safely. Everything the workers care about lives in one config block, shown here for reference.

settings of bafof-yagef:
JOROX_PIN=8740
JOROX_TENANT=pelox
JOROX_METRICS_HOST=metrics.jorox.qorvelworks.internal
JOROX_SEAL=seal_c78f63c1
JOROX_STANDBY_TEAM=norax

Facilities ticket — Halewick Tower, night shift.

Issue: support team reporting east stairwell reader rejecting badges after midnight. Reader was reset this morning; firmware updated. Overnight crew should now badge as normal. If the reader fails again, use the manual keypad by the fire door — do not prop the door. Log any further failures with the time and badge name. Temporary keypad code for the fallback door is below.

door code, tajeg-fawip: bdg-K-62

Hey — before you can review my branch, heads up: the Brimworth secrets vault that holds the QueueLift scaling tokens locked itself again after the cert rotation. The autoscaler reads queue-depth metrics from Pondermill, and without the vault open, the integration tests just hang, so don't blame your review env. I already pinged the platform folks; they said any reviewer can unseal it themselves. Pop open the vault CLI, pick the QueueLift realm, and paste in the recovery passphrase below.

vault phrase of tagaf-hawef = jordor-wenok-gorael-wenion-keleth-sorion-wenys-novix-fenir-fraax-fenael-aldius-fraok